On 11 Jun 2001 14:01:09 -0700, Cory Dodt wrote:
> - GnuCash still doesn't remember its geometry. It always appears in the corner, 
>curled up in the fetal position.

There is a bug in saving the geometry/state if you close gnucash with
the window controls instead of File->Exit or the exit toolbar button.
Is this the same bug?


> - You ought to be able to keep the registers in the main window as tabs.  Quicken 
>had the right idea on this.  If you want to detach them, a widget on the window can 
>be available to do that.

Definitely.


> - Restore from logs available when you crash.

That's part of the XML logs -- the reason for putting
them in XML is so they can be easily replayed :)


> - Hidden accounts.  My account list is cluttered with closed accounts now - credit 
>cards that were cancelled, bank accounts that were closed, accounts receivable (loans 
>to my friends and rebates I've sent away for) already collected, etc.
> 
> - Global memorized transaction list. If I shop at Pak 'n Save and pay with my check 
>card one day and my credit card the next day, the same memorized transaction should 
>show up in both.

These are both good things, too.
